It is crucial for customers to be aware of and adhere to U.S. Customs and Border Protection (CBP) duty-free personal exemption limits. For goods brought back from Mexico, the current duty-free exemption is $800 per person for items in your possession, provided you have remained outside the U.S. for no less than 48 hours. Amounts exceeding this are subject to appropriate duties. Families living in the same household and returning together may be able to combine their exemptions. Always consult the official CBP website or inquire at the store for the most up-to-date regulations.
